Project Runway den father Tim Gunn is really making a name for himself around New York—as the fashion industry's resident mean girl. Whether his stories are true or not, Gunn just can't resist running around town running his mouth—repeatedly harping on the same old stories. In the past couple of weeks, he's been busy calling Vogue a "monkey house," going on national television saying Conde Nast needs to put its employees in straitjckets, viciously slagging off Isaac Mizrahi (who everyone else in the industry really actually seems to like very much, thank you), and telling the story of Anna Wintour being carried downstairs over and over and over again. Ad infinitum.
Today, Gunn has a new target for his vitriol: Taylor Momsen. After he was given a cameo part on the hit show Gossip Girl, Gunn couldn't help but turn around and talk smack about some of the show's stars. "What a diva!" Gunn told E! about Taylor Momsen after his appearance on the show. "She was pathetic, she couldn't remember her lines, and she didn't even have that many. I thought to myself 'why are we all being held hostage by this brat?"
Gunn also goes after the cast of the Real Housewives of New Jersey, calling them animals: "We've gone back to the Colosseum where we watch people rip each other limb to limb. I want a DNA test—how far are these women from wild animals? What do they take from this behavior? My advice is to take the high road. You'll never regret it. I've been pushed, but I discipline myself and an hour later I'm so grateful."
The high road, indeed.
